Package net.risesoft.service.form
Interface Y9TableFieldService
-
- All Known Implementing Classes:
Y9TableFieldServiceImpl
public interface Y9TableFieldService- Author:
- qinman, zhangchongjie
- Date:
- 2022/12/20
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description voiddelete(String id)根据id删除表字段定义Y9TableFieldfindById(String id)根据id获取表字段定义List<Y9TableField>listByTableId(String tableId)根据表id获取表字段定义List<Y9TableField>listByTableIdAndState(String tableId, Integer state)取出当前表定义字段List<Y9TableField>listByTableIdOrderByDisplay(String tableId)取出当前表定义字段List<Y9TableField>listSystemFieldByTableId(String tableId)获取字段系统主键Y9TableFieldsaveOrUpdate(Y9TableField field)保存表字段信息voidupdateState(String tableId)修改字段状态
-
-
-
Method Detail
-
delete
void delete(String id)
根据id删除表字段定义- Parameters:
id-
-
findById
Y9TableField findById(String id)
根据id获取表字段定义- Parameters:
id-- Returns:
-
listByTableId
List<Y9TableField> listByTableId(String tableId)
根据表id获取表字段定义- Parameters:
tableId-- Returns:
-
listByTableIdAndState
List<Y9TableField> listByTableIdAndState(String tableId, Integer state)
取出当前表定义字段- Parameters:
tableId-state- 字段状态 :-1未生成表字段,1为已经生成表字段- Returns:
-
listByTableIdOrderByDisplay
List<Y9TableField> listByTableIdOrderByDisplay(String tableId)
取出当前表定义字段- Parameters:
tableId-- Returns:
-
listSystemFieldByTableId
List<Y9TableField> listSystemFieldByTableId(String tableId)
获取字段系统主键- Parameters:
tableId-- Returns:
-
saveOrUpdate
Y9TableField saveOrUpdate(Y9TableField field)
保存表字段信息- Parameters:
field-- Returns:
-
updateState
void updateState(String tableId)
修改字段状态- Parameters:
tableId-
-
-